vb.org Archive

vb.org Archive (https://vborg.vbsupport.ru/index.php)
-   vBulletin 3.8 Add-ons (https://vborg.vbsupport.ru/forumdisplay.php?f=235)
-   -   Add-On Releases - SEOvB - Link Canonicalization for vBulletin Stop Duplicate Content NOW! (https://vborg.vbsupport.ru/showthread.php?t=205512)

SEOvB 02-21-2009 12:20 AM

Quote:

Originally Posted by djbaxter (Post 1750194)
vBSEO claims that their package already filters duplicate URLs so why do they need the tags? :rolleyes:

Probably best left to the vBSEO guys, as I'm not sure why it'd be needed either if they already truly had achieved "link consensus" previously.:erm:

redlabour 02-21-2009 06:25 AM

Simple answer :

Quote:

Enable Canonical URLs NEW!
A canonical URL is the "Preferred" URL for any page. Some pages have more than one accessible URL, creating a duplicate content problem. Google and other search engines now look for a META parameter rel="canonical", and use this as a hint to determine which URL is the correct one to index, i.e. the preferred version.

vBSEO's built in Link Consensus ensures that all pages on your forum are canonical to begin with, allowing for only one URL per resource. vBSEO's native canonical URLs provide advantages including greater crawling efficiency, optimized external linking, maximized link value. This is not provided with the rel="canonical" parameter alone. vBSEO's Application level link consensus is required for these advantages.

However, Google's canonical hints are helpful as a backup for URLs such as custom sorted pages. This level of redundancy will ensure that if search engines ever discover the sorting URLs, they will be instructed of the correct page URL for link consensus the first time they crawl the page. Examples include custom sorted versions of forumdisplay, social group discussions, member and blog lists, etc.

MTGDarkness 02-21-2009 12:22 PM

Will this work on 3.7.x?

djbaxter 02-21-2009 12:58 PM

Quote:

Originally Posted by redlabour (Post 1750456)
Simple answer :
Quote:

Enable Canonical URLs NEW!
A canonical URL is the "Preferred" URL for any page. Some pages have more than one accessible URL, creating a duplicate content problem. Google and other search engines now look for a META parameter rel="canonical", and use this as a hint to determine which URL is the correct one to index, i.e. the preferred version.

vBSEO's built in Link Consensus ensures that all pages on your forum are canonical to begin with, allowing for only one URL per resource. vBSEO's native canonical URLs provide advantages including greater crawling efficiency, optimized external linking, maximized link value. This is not provided with the rel="canonical" parameter alone. vBSEO's Application level link consensus is required for these advantages.

However, Google's canonical hints are helpful as a backup for URLs such as custom sorted pages. This level of redundancy will ensure that if search engines ever discover the sorting URLs, they will be instructed of the correct page URL for link consensus the first time they crawl the page. Examples include custom sorted versions of forumdisplay, social group discussions, member and blog lists, etc.

That's neither simple nor an answer. That's a sales pitch.

And as FRDS points out above and as I said originally, to get back to THIS thread and THIS add-on, if you're using vBSEO you don't need this add-on. Move along people... nothing to see here...

roddy 02-22-2009 10:33 AM

Ignore, either I messed up, or now it's magically working. Either way, clicking install . . .

roddy 02-22-2009 10:44 AM

Ok, there is a problem here.
showthread.php?t=26237&page=9 > works fine

showthread.php?p=179223#post179223 > doesn't work.

Am seeing if I can figure it out, but probably I can't . . .

Edit: It does work if you paste it in below "$headinclude" in SHOWTHREAD. But not in SHOWTHREAD_SHOWPOST

abilitydesigns 03-01-2009 06:04 PM

total vbulletin newbie here.

Pardon my ignorance, but can anybody walk me thro' the process of installing this mod?

i downloaded the file but don't know what to do next? ( there's no read me? )

again sorry for such a basic question

AD

gwerzal 03-01-2009 10:53 PM

good idea.

Will install it later

brandonroy 03-12-2009 07:59 AM

Installed. I did the manual edit and I took out this:

Code:

<if condition="THIS_SCRIPT == index">
<link rel="canonical" href="$vboptions[bburl]" />
</if>

Because I have my forum index set to /forum.php and it was adding <link rel="canonical" href="http://www.example.com" /> to forum.php which is not what I wanted!

Is that ok?

EDIT:
And also, if a post is on page=2 or page=3, etc - Shouldn't the showpost.php?p= have the canonical URL of showthread.php?t=555&page=2 instead of just showthread.php?t=555 ? Or is that not a big deal?

MTGDarkness 03-13-2009 08:24 PM

It's working fine with vBulletin 3.7.x. Question-should the canonicals specify which page in a thread you're on? I'm using it with the TFSEO URL Rewrite, and I'm (of course) worried about conflicts. Like, regardless of what page I am on in a thread, it sends me to the first page with the canonical. Should that happen?


All times are GMT. The time now is 04:15 PM.

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.

X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.01121 seconds
  • Memory Usage 1,741KB
  • Queries Executed 10 (?)
More Information
Template Usage:
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)bbcode_code_printable
  • (4)bbcode_quote_printable
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(4)pagenav_pagelink
  • (1)post_thanks_navbar_search
  • (1)printthread
  • (10)printthreadbit
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• showthread
Included Files:
  • ./printth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/class_bbcode_alt.php
  • ./includes/class_bbcode.php
  • ./includes/functions_bigthree.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• printthread_start
  • pagenav_page
  • pagenav_complete
  • bbcode_fetch_tags
  • bbcode_create
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• printthread_post
  • printthread_complete